What are similar figures?

Back

Similar figures are shapes that have the same shape but may differ in size. Their corresponding angles are equal, and their corresponding sides are proportional.

What does it mean for sides to be proportional in similar figures?

Back

In similar figures, the lengths of corresponding sides are in the same ratio, meaning they can be expressed as a fraction that is equal.

What is the relationship between corresponding angles in similar figures?

Back

In similar figures, corresponding angles are congruent, meaning they have the same measure.

If two triangles are similar, how do you find a missing side length?

Back

To find a missing side length in similar triangles, set up a proportion using the lengths of the corresponding sides.

If triangle ABC is similar to triangle DEF, and the length of side AB is 4 cm and side DE is 8 cm, what is the ratio of their sides?

Back

The ratio of their sides is 1:2.

How do you determine if two figures are similar?

Back

Two figures are similar if their corresponding angles are equal and the lengths of their corresponding sides are proportional.
